Abstract
This paper proposes methods of quickly estimating the maximum values o f noise background in the fields of view of optoelectronic devices for the celestial orientation and navigation of spacecraft when the entra nce windows of the protective hoods receive illumination from objects beyond the limits of the fields of view of these devices.
